Understanding GLP-1 Medications
GLP-1 receptor agonists are a class of drugs primarily used to treat Type 2 diabetes and, more just recently, persistent weight management. They work by mimicking a natural hormone that promotes insulin secretion, slows stomach emptying, and signals satiety to the brain.

In Germany, the most recognized brand names include:

Price in the German health care system depends greatly on whether a client is covered by Public Health Insurance (Gesetzliche Krankenversicherung - GKV) or Private Health Insurance (Private Krankenversicherung - PKV), and the specific diagnosis provided by a doctor.
1. Public Health Insurance (GKV)
For clients with Type 2 diabetes, GLP-1 medications are usually covered by the GKV. The client normally pays only the requirement "Zuzahlung" (co-payment), which ranges from EUR5 to EUR10 per prescription.

However, for weight problems treatment (without a diabetes diagnosis), the situation is various. Under existing German law (particularly § 34 SGB V), medications primarily planned for weight loss are frequently classified as "lifestyle drugs" and are omitted from the GKV's basic advantage brochure. This suggests clients seeking Wegovy or Saxenda for weight reduction often need to pay the full retail price.
2. Private Health Insurance (PKV)
Private insurance companies vary in their protection. Lots of PKV suppliers will repay the cost of GLP-1 medications if a physician deems it "clinically needed"-- for instance, if a patient has a BMI over 30 or a BMI over 27 with comorbidities like hypertension.
Comparative Costs of GLP-1 Medications in Germany
For those paying out-of-pocket (the "Selbstzahler"), rates are controlled by means of the Arzneimittelpreisverordnung (Pharmacy Pricing Ordinance), but they still represent a significant month-to-month financial investment.
Table 1: Estimated Monthly Costs for Self-Payers (2024 Estimates)MedicationMain UseActive IngredientApproximated Monthly Cost (Self-Pay)OzempicType 2 DiabetesSemaglutideEUR80-- EUR110WegovyWeight LossSemaglutideEUR170-- EUR300+ (Dose dependent)RybelsusType 2 DiabetesSemaglutideEUR100-- EUR140MounjaroDiabetes/ ObesityTirzepatideEUR250-- EUR400SaxendaWeight-lossLiraglutideEUR200-- EUR300
Keep in mind: Prices vary depending on the dosage strength and the size of the pack (e.g., a 3-month supply is generally more cost-effective than a 1-month supply).

While the base cost of these medications is rather repaired by guideline, there are methods to handle the financial problem.
1. Requesting Larger Pack Sizes
In Germany, medications are typically sold in N1, N2, or N3 pack sizes. An N3 pack generally consists of a three-month supply. For self-payers, purchasing an N3 pack is usually less expensive per dosage than purchasing three specific N1 packs.

Typical Challenges: Shortages and "Gray Market" Risks
Germany, like much of the world, has faced Ozempic lacks. To combat this, the BfArM (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ices) has occasionally limited using Ozempic solely to diabetes patients to make sure supply.
